As wine bar prepares to open, Washington Square seeks right fit for the rest

Oct. 5, 2018

When Wine Time on Main opens later this month at Washington Square, the downtown building will be down to one remaining commercial space.

The upscale wine bar will complement Parlour Ice Cream House, which opened earlier this year.

“Both Wine Time and Parlour are first-class operations that really show what’s possible for retail at Washington Square,” said Raquel Blount of Lloyd Cos., who represents the building.

“Parlour has been tremendously well-received by downtown and by the residents at Washington Square, and we know Wine Time is going to deliver a similar experience.”

As residents have moved into the building, which now has only about 25 percent of its residential space left, activity for the commercial space below also has increased, Blount said.

“It’s a built-in clientele of residents who love supporting downtown businesses, as well as their guests who also love to spend time in the building,” Blount said. “Our office space on the fourth floor also is entirely full, so as those businesses have moved in with their employees, we’ve seen a positive effect on the nearby businesses.”

There’s 5,500 square feet remaining on the first floor, Blount said.

“Our vision continues to be for a full-service, destination restaurant,” she said. “We’ve had significant interest and feel it’s only a matter of time before the right deal comes together. The building is eager to support whoever chooses to invest in a business at that location.”

The space also could be subdivided, she said, and includes options for outdoor seating.

“We’ve had strong regional operators as well as local restaurateurs look at it,” Blount said. “With the Washington Pavilion across the street and 125 enclosed parking spaces available above the restaurant, it offers a very unique opportunity for a downtown establishment. We’re confident someone is going to be eager to take advantage of it.”
